CVE-2025-6720: Vchasno Kasa <= 1.0.3 - Unauthenticated Log File Clearing

Vendor Bandido
Product MORKVA Vchasno Kasa Integration
Weakness CWE-862 · Missing authorization
Published July 19, 2025
Last update April 8, 2026

CVSS base score

5.3/10
Attack vector Network
Attack complexity Low
Privileges required None
User interaction None
Confidentiality None
Integrity Low

CVSS vector

C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:L/A:N

What the vulnerability does

01Description

The Vchasno Kasa pl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to unauthorized loss of data due to a missing capability check on the clear_all_log() function in all versions up to, and including, 1.0.3.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to clear log files.
